Chevrolet Aveo Intake Manifold Parts Questions & Experts Answers

  • Q: How to replace the intake manifold with variable camshaft phasing on Chevrolet Aveo?
    A:
    Start your Intake Manifold replacement by disconnecting the negative Battery Cable. First lower the fuel pressure before removing the air cleaner assembly. Start by disconnecting the Intake Manifold power steering pressure pipe clamp followed by removing sensor and actuator connectors from their mounting points and pulling the engine wiring harness away. You must first separate the Fuel Rail's fuel line and subsequently disconnect the etc coolant inlet/outlet hoses before moving them to the side. Free the pcv hose from both the cylinder head cover and the etc unit. Disassemble the electric throttle controller (ETC) while simultaneously taking out the Intake Manifold with its gasket. New gaskets should be used during installation and bolts securing the Intake Manifold should be tightened to 20 nm (14.7 lb ft) and the lower bracket bolt should receive 8 nm (70.8 lb in) torque. First reassemble the electric throttle controller (ETC) alongside the cylinder head cover before attaching the pcv hose to the etc and mounting the etc coolant inlet/outlet hoses. Install the fuel line to the Fuel Rail while connecting each sensor and actuator connector that includes the a/c pressure sensor (ACP) and cam position solenoid valve in addition to the electric throttle controller (ETC) and manifold air pressure (MAP) sensor and evap solenoid valve and injectors. The power steering pressure pipe gets attached to the Intake Manifold while reinstalling the air cleaner assembly with the battery negative cable connection completed.
